Arbor Networks' Threat Management System Addressing Critical Security and Operational Issues of Service Providers

Posted on: Wednesday, 18 July 2007, 09:18 CDT

Arbor Networks, a leading provider of network security and operational performance for global business networks, announced today that the Threat Management System (TMS) that provides carrier-class, deep packet inspection, has been met with broad market acceptance by service providers because of its ability to identify and stop distributed denial of service (DDoS) attacks without interrupting the flow of legitimate traffic. Additionally, TMS is an ideal platform for service providers who are looking to offer revenue generating managed security services to their enterprise customers.

"Arbor's TMS seamlessly integrates with Peakflow SP allowing a service provider to detect, analyze and block a denial-of-service attack from a single pane of glass," said Paul Morville, Arbor's vice president of product management. "The ability to detect and block these attacks is a basic requirement of any market-leading managed security solution and is critical to ensuring Internet availability as a whole."

Arbor's Peakflow SP platform currently protects more than 70% of the world's Internet service provider (ISP) networks from security threats, such as DDoS attacks, botnets and worms, as well as network issues such as traffic and routing instability. With the integrated Threat Management System, the Peakflow SP platform is unique in its ability to detect, analyze and mitigate threats across entire ISP networks, a combination that delivers significant operational savings by consolidating multiple tools while decreasing operator response time to debilitating network attacks.

Key Features and Benefits of Arbor's Threat Management System

 --  Integrated: Part of a comprehensive, fully integrated solution for     cost effective threat detection and mitigation.      --  Surgical Mitigation: Automatically identify and remove only attack     traffic without interrupting the flow of legitimate business traffic.      --  Application-aware: Complements pervasive network visibility with deep     packet inspection of critical applications such as DNS, HTTP, VoIP, IM and     P2P.
